The Premier League: England's Football Kingdom
Ah, the English Premier League, the undisputed king of popularity! If you're new to football, this is probably where you'll start. It's the most-watched league globally, and for good reason. The Premier League is famous for its fast-paced, high-energy matches, and the sheer unpredictability of the results. Every weekend, millions tune in to witness the drama, the goals, and the upsets that define this league. The Premier League's popularity stems from a perfect mix of factors, including its competitive nature, star players, and the massive financial investments made by its clubs. The league is a melting pot of talent from all over the world, making every match a showcase of skill and excitement. This is a league where anything can happen.
The Premier League is a financial powerhouse, with huge TV deals that allow clubs to attract top talent. This competitiveness keeps fans on the edge of their seats. The league is known for its intense rivalries, such as the Manchester Derby, the North London Derby, and the Merseyside Derby, which add to the drama and passion of the matches. There are historic clubs like Manchester United, Liverpool, Arsenal, and Chelsea, who have a rich history of success, and they consistently compete for the title and the Champions League spots. Clubs like Manchester City have also emerged as major forces, thanks to significant investments, creating a dynamic landscape where the balance of power can shift quickly. The Premier League is where you’ll see the best attacking football, with many goals and end-to-end action. La Liga: Spain's Tactical Showcase
Next up, we have La Liga from Spain. This league is renowned for its technical skill, tactical depth, and the legendary rivalry between Real Madrid and Barcelona, or El Clásico, one of the most-watched football matches in the world! La Liga is known for its emphasis on possession-based football, with teams often focusing on patient build-up play and intricate passing. This style of play often features a creative flair and showcases some of the world's most talented players. This style creates matches that are not only exciting but also tactically intriguing. The league is home to iconic clubs like Real Madrid, Barcelona, and Atlético Madrid. These teams have dominated European football for years and have a long history of success.
Real Madrid's history is filled with Champions League titles, and Barcelona is known for its unique style. Atlético Madrid has emerged as a major force under manager Diego Simeone. Serie A: Italy's Defensive Fortress
Now, let's head to Italy and talk about Serie A. This league is famous for its defensive tactics, tactical prowess, and the passionate support of its fans. Serie A is a tactical battleground where defensive solidity is as important as attacking flair. Teams in Serie A are known for their organized defenses, tactical discipline, and their ability to frustrate their opponents. This makes the matches very interesting. The league is home to clubs like Juventus, AC Milan, and Inter Milan, all of which have a rich history of success. These clubs are known for their star players, tactical brilliance, and passionate fan bases.
Juventus has long dominated the league, AC Milan has a storied history, and Inter Milan has always been a force. Serie A offers a different style of football compared to the Premier League and La Liga. The matches are known for their tactical depth, defensive battles, and the strategic adjustments made by managers throughout the game. The league’s history is filled with iconic players, legendary matches, and unforgettable moments. Serie A clubs have a track record of success in European competitions, reflecting their high level of play. Bundesliga: Germany's Goal-Fest
Next, we're off to Germany to talk about Bundesliga. Bundesliga is known for its high-scoring matches, passionate fans, and the success of Bayern Munich. Bundesliga is known for its high-scoring matches and attacking football. Fans can expect to see a lot of goals. Bayern Munich has dominated the league for many years, but other clubs like Borussia Dortmund are also constantly in the mix, adding competitiveness to the league. The fan culture in Germany is among the best in the world, with fans known for their passion, their chants, and the amazing atmosphere they create in the stadiums.
The Bundesliga is known for its focus on youth development, nurturing young talents and providing them with opportunities to shine. Bayern Munich's dominance over the years has been a key feature of the league, with the club consistently winning titles and competing in the Champions League. However, other clubs have emerged to challenge Bayern, making the league more competitive and exciting. Borussia Dortmund is known for its high-energy, attacking style of play and its passionate fan base. Ligue 1: France's Rising Star
Finally, we journey to France to discuss Ligue 1. Ligue 1 is known for the dominance of Paris Saint-Germain (PSG), the rise of young talents, and the exciting matches. Ligue 1 has become increasingly competitive, with clubs like PSG dominating the league and attracting some of the world's best players. The league is also a breeding ground for young talent, with many promising players making their mark in the top European leagues. The presence of PSG has brought global attention to Ligue 1.
PSG’s financial power and star-studded squad has made the club the team to beat. However, other clubs like Olympique Lyonnais, AS Monaco, and Lille have also shown their strength, creating excitement in the league. Beyond the Big Five
While the Premier League, La Liga, Serie A, Bundesliga, and Ligue 1 are the most famous, there are other exciting leagues in Europe, such as the Eredivisie (Netherlands), the Primeira Liga (Portugal), and the Belgian Pro League. These leagues offer unique styles of play, develop talented players, and provide exciting matches. They serve as platforms for emerging talent, providing them with opportunities to showcase their skills before moving to bigger leagues. These leagues are full of passion and excitement.
